Conduct preventive routine maintenance of pipettes: repairing challenges when they come about isn't more than enough. Make preventive maintenance and calibration component of the regime. right preventive servicing normally features replacing portions of the pipette that could have on down, such as seals and o-rings, as well as re-greasing mechanical components. For entire Guidance on right servicing, check with the producer's guidelines.

Chemical laboratory: These laboratories use micropipettes to take care of viscous and unstable liquids for a variety of experiments. Forensic laboratory: These laboratories use micropipettes to research blood, tissues, and fibers. Micropipettes are also helpful assessments that decide the genetics of victims or analysis of DNA components and fingerprints uncovered in the criminal offense scene.
